Hello, if anyone has seen this, i would be thankful to help me resolve
this. We seem to have an indexing issue on the ldap server (running
Debian/sid).
>From the logs i am getting :
slapd[1578]: daemon: read activity on 23
slapd[1593]: <= bdb_equality_candidates: (uid) index_param failed (18)
slapd[1578]: daemon: select: listen=6 active_threads=1 tvp=NULL
slapd[1578]: daemon: select: listen=7 active_threads=1 tvp=NULL
slapd[1578]: daemon: select: listen=8 active_threads=1 tvp=NULL
slapd[1578]: daemon: select: listen=9 active_threads=1 tvp=NULL
It seems that error has been filling the debug in /var/log for quite some time.
The server itself works as expected, user login/pass works, querying
the db also although the db locked hard about an hour ago and i had to
do a nasty db4.2_recover to get it back in (semi) clean state.
Has anyone seen this and more importantly know how to fix it ?
